Gunkulkondapur

Ganneruvaram block · Karimnagar district, Telangana · PIN 505530 · village code 572501

The 2020 population figure for this village looks unreliable, so no change is shown. Census 2011 recorded 4,788 people; Mission Antyodaya 2020 recorded 1,981 — a drop of more than 40%. One of the two is wrong and we cannot tell which.

Census 2011

Total population
4,788
Male / female
2,401 / 2,387
Sex ratio females per 1,000 males
994
Children aged 0–6
400
Literacy rate
57.2%
Scheduled Caste / Scheduled Tribe
1,166 / 42
Working population
2,612
Of workers, in agriculture cultivators and farm labour
80.9%
Households
1,270

Village facilities, 2020

This village spans 3 gram panchayats and was surveyed once by each. The figures below are from Gunkulkondapoor panchayat's return.

Primary school
Yes
Middle school
Yes
High school nearest 2 km away
No
Piped tap water
100% habitations covered
All-weather road
Yes
Public transport
Auto
Electricity
8-12 Hrs
Bank
Yes
Primary health centre
Sub Centre
Anganwadi
Yes
Internet
Yes
Common service centre
Separately located

Farming

Farm households
260
Non-farm households
230
Share of households farming, 2020
53%
Net sown area
1,477 ha
Kharif / rabi / other hidden inside one column
1,477 / 1,477 / 0
Main irrigation source
Ground water (tube well/well/pump)
